Bottom line, if they shipped without memory, then Dell could NOT provide warranty support, as they would have no way of ensuring that the memory you added was not the problem. They often require you to return your configuration to factory shipped prior to warranty service to ensure that you add-ons were not the problem. A perfectly reasonable approach.
